Great to meet you!

Hello, my name is Steven Cospewicz and have been a therapist since 2011 when I graduated from USC. I believe that active listening and a warm, inquisitive, and non judgmental approach allows you to feel safe and heard.

My approach to therapy

I use an eclectic approach, with many of the interventions coming from CBT (Cognitive Behavioral Therapy) and Motivational Interviewing. I use a lot of Socratic Questioning to identify the root of the issues. I focus diagnostically on mild to moderate anxiety and depression, and well as those who identify as LGBTQ+.

What you can expect from me

Overarching goals, as well as short term, and long term goals with be identified early on and relied on to guide our process together and well as provide you with tangible tools you can use moving forward.
